The following message (subject: Re: shakehand or penhold?) was posted by cur, on 7/13/2004 1:10:03 PM:
Im thinking you're right :-) Sriver is good for that style which is in fact the drive style since you loop away from the table. Quick attack stays at the table more. Also if you want a good blade from butterfly, then cypress is a good one for start. I used that one when I first got into that style. Eventually I wanted more power and moved to the Kim Taek Soo Blade which is rather expensive. Now I have recently switched my rubber to bryce which is a more offensive rubber than Sriver. Speed glue may be something you will consider in the future.(If you dont use it now) |
